CLIMBING NEW PEAKS

A 2023-2027 STRATEGIC PLAN FOR BLACK HILLS STATE UNIVERSITY


Goal 1- Nurturing Student Experience

 

GOAL STATEMENT: Enhance the student experience through innovative engagement, holistic support, and a vibrant student-centered spirit.

OBJECTIVES

Objective 1: Strengthen and celebrate the authenticity of our small-campus culture through increased focus on student participation and satisfaction.

  • Assess student programming interests across various demographics at the Rapid City, Ellsworth, and Spearfish campuses.

  • Establish a Leadership certificate program.

  • Increase student participation in the NSSE survey.

  • Improve the training and the number of campus staff members who support student engagement.

Objective 2: Enhance the student residential experience through engaging residential curriculum and through scheduled infrastructure and facility upgrades.

  • Create and maintain compelling Living Learning Community options for our students.

  • Develop a sustainable replacement schedule for the furniture and fixtures in each residence hall.

  • Improve the Student Union facilities and program offerings.

Objective 3: Implement student-centered policies, procedures, and services to simplify all non-academic student-campus transactions.

  • Improve campus safety by fully staffing the Public Safety Office.

  • Assess and streamline all student-facing policies and procedures.

  • Revamp the current bias-response system.

  • Increase the quality, clarity, and timeliness of campus communications.

Objective 4: Improve our mental and physical wellness services targeting reduced wait times for counselling and enhanced healthcare service partnerships.

  • Support student mental health through bolstering mental health offerings and programming.

  • Hire Counseling Center Director

  • Explore other mental health support offerings

  • Develop Programs and Services through a partnership with the Lost & Found Organization, including the peer mentoring program and mental health triage training for faculty and staff.

  • Increase JacketHub training and usage campus wide for early intervention(s).

  • Explore partnership with Spearfish Rec Center to offer classes at discounted rate.

  • Assess needs/wants of student participants

Objective 5: Foster a rich array of career- and leadership-development opportunities for our students.

  • Assist students as they explore and identify their academic majors.

  • Increase internship opportunities in the Black Hills region.

  • Offer robust leadership training for students.

  • Improve student readiness for job searches and career planning.

Objective 6: Fulfill the student-focused goals of the strategic enrollment plan finalized in April 2021.

  • Launch an expanded Career Center.

  • Complete the transition to a professional advising model.

  • Improve tutoring and supplemental instruction.

  • Develop work-study internships throughout the University.
